Aoun’s share is the largest of the ministerial portfolios
The new Lebanese government was born today, Friday, after more than a year of emptiness.
Below are the ministerial quotas for each team:
President Michel Aoun’s share:
- Saadeh Al-Shami (Syrian Social Nationalist Party)
- Abdullah Bu Habib (Aoun)
- Maurice Selim (Aoun)
- Walid Fayyad (MP Gebran Bassil)
- Henry Khoury (Aoun)
- Hector Hajjar (Aoun)
- Georges Bojekian (Teshnak)
- Issam Sharaf El-Din (MP Talal Arslan)
The share of Prime Minister Najib Mikati and former Prime Minister Saad Hariri:
- Bassam Mawlawi
- Amin Salam
- Firas Abyad
- Nasser Yassin
Aoun and Mikati:
- Walid Nassar (close to Aoun)
- George Kallas (Amal Movement)
- Najla Riachy (close to Mikati)
The Shiite duo:
- Youssef Khalil (Amal Movement)
- Mustafa Bayrom (Amal Movement)
- Abbas Hajj Hassan (Amal Movement)
- Ali Hamiya (Hezbollah)
- Muhammad Mortada (Hezbollah)
Marada stream
- George Corm
- George Kordahi
